Why Choose a 2018 Ford Mustang GT?

The used 2018 Ford Mustang GT for sale isn't just any car; it's a statement. Here's why it stands out:

  • Powerful Performance: The heart of the 2018 Mustang GT is its 5.0-liter Coyote V8 engine, delivering a thrilling 460 horsepower and 420 lb-ft of torque. This powerhouse allows the Mustang GT to sprint from 0 to 60 mph in under 4 seconds with the available 10-speed automatic transmission. Whether you're cruising down the highway or hitting the track, the 2018 Mustang GT offers an exhilarating driving experience that few cars can match.
  • Updated Styling: The 2018 model year brought a refreshed design with a lower hood, revised front fascia, and LED lighting. These updates give the Mustang GT a more aggressive and modern look, ensuring it turns heads wherever it goes. The sleek lines and aerodynamic enhancements not only improve the car's aesthetics but also contribute to its overall performance.
  • Advanced Technology: Inside, you'll find an available 12-inch digital instrument cluster that can be customized to display various performance metrics. The SYNC 3 infotainment system offers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ility, making it easy to stay connected on the go. The inclusion of advanced driver-assistance features like adaptive cruise control and pre-collision assist further enhances the driving experience, providing added safety and convenience.
  • Improved Handling: The 2018 Mustang GT features an independent rear suspension, which significantly improves handling and ride comfort compared to previous generations. Optional MagneRide dampers provide even greater control and responsiveness, adapting to road conditions in real-time to deliver a smooth yet engaging ride. This makes the 2018 Mustang GT a capable performer on both the street and the track.
  • Customization Options: Ford offered a wide range of options and packages for the 2018 Mustang GT, allowing buyers to tailor the car to their specific preferences. From performance upgrades like the GT Performance Package to aesthetic enhancements like different wheel designs and interior trim options, there's a 2018 Mustang GT out there to suit every taste. Common Issues with the 2018 Ford Mustang GT

Even the mighty Mustang isn't immune to potential problems. Knowing these common issues can help you spot them during your inspection of a used 2018 Ford Mustang GT for sale:

  • Transmission Problems: Some owners have reported issues with the 10-speed automatic transmission, including harsh shifting and hesitation. Be sure to test the transmission thoroughly during your test drive.
  • Oil Consumption: The 5.0-liter Coyote engine can sometimes suffer from excessive oil consumption. Check the oil level regularly and be aware of any blue smoke coming from the exhaust, which could indicate burning oil.
  • Electrical Issues: Some owners have reported electrical problems, such as issues with the infotainment system or the digital instrument cluster. Test all electronic features to ensure they are working properly.
  • Paint Quality: Ford's paint quality has been a concern for some owners, with reports of chipping and peeling. Inspect the paint carefully for any signs of damage.
